
Diagrama de dependencias de un proyecto
Un diagrama de dependencias es una representación visual de las relaciones entre tareas o componentes dentro de un proyecto. Identifica predecesores y sucesores para garantizar un flujo de trabajo lógico, permitiendo a los directores de proyecto visualizar la ruta crítica y gestionar las restricciones de manera eficaz para evitar retrasos en el cronograma.
En proyectos complejos, la claridad marca la diferencia entre una entrega puntual y un fallo en cascada. Cuando decenas de tareas se interconectan entre múltiples equipos, una sola dependencia no rastreada puede paralizar todo un programa. El diagrama de dependencias resuelve este problema haciendo que cada relación sea visible, explícita y accionable, convirtiendo listas abstractas de tareas en una hoja de ruta interconectada que toda tu organización puede navegar.
¿Qué es un diagrama de dependencias?
Un diagrama de dependencias, también llamado diagrama de red o diagrama de precedencia, es un modelo visual estructurado que mapea qué tareas del proyecto deben completarse antes de que otras puedan comenzar (o terminar). Cada nodo en el diagrama representa una tarea o entregable; cada flecha o arista codifica una restricción lógica entre dos nodos.
Los diagramas de dependencias de proyecto son un pilar fundamental del desarrollo del cronograma en la Guía del PMBOK® (Octava Edición). Se alimentan directamente del método de la ruta crítica (CPM), la nivelación de recursos y la identificación de riesgos, lo que los hace indispensables para cualquier director de proyectos que gestione trabajo con interdependencias complejas.
A diferencia de una simple lista de tareas o un diagrama de Gantt, un diagrama de dependencias expone el porqué detrás de cada secuencia. Los equipos dejan de preguntarse “¿por qué está bloqueada la Tarea 17?” y empiezan a ver la respuesta de un vistazo.

Dependency graph vs. diagrama de dependencias: diferencias clave
Estos dos términos se usan con frecuencia de forma intercambiable, pero existe una distinción significativa que revela tu nivel de experiencia:
- Dependency Graph (Grafo de dependencias): Un concepto matemático de la teoría de grafos. Los nodos y las aristas dirigidas representan componentes y sus relaciones en un sentido formal y algorítmico. Se utiliza ampliamente en ingeniería de software (gestores de paquetes, sistemas de compilación, pipelines de compiladores) y ciencia de datos (DAGs en Apache Airflow, grafos de linaje en dbt).
- Diagrama de dependencias (Dependency Chart): La adaptación del concepto de grafo a la dirección de proyectos. Añade lógica de negocio encima, con nombres de tareas, duraciones, responsables, indicadores de hitos y restricciones de cronograma. Herramientas como Microsoft Project, Primavera P6 y Monday.com renderizan los diagramas de dependencias como diagramas interactivos o redes vinculadas al Gantt.
Para un arquitecto de software que mapea cadenas de llamadas entre microservicios, el enfoque de “dependency graph” es el correcto. Para un director de proyectos que planifica el lanzamiento de un producto, el “diagrama de dependencias” o “plantilla de dependencias de gestión de proyectos” es el instrumento adecuado.
¿Cuál es el propósito de un diagrama de dependencias?
El diagrama de dependencias cumple cuatro propósitos estratégicos que ninguna hoja de cálculo ni reunión verbal puede replicar:
- Identificación de cuellos de botella: Visualizar de forma explícita las tareas con muchas dependencias entrantes, los nodos donde los retrasos se acumulan y se propagan aguas abajo.
- Visibilidad de la ruta crítica: La secuencia de tareas con flotación cero determina la fecha de finalización más temprana posible del proyecto. Un diagrama de dependencias hace que esta ruta sea inconfundible.
- Gestión de riesgos: Las dependencias externas (entregables de terceros, aprobaciones regulatorias, hitos de proveedores) aparecen como nodos explícitos, lo que impulsa una planificación de contingencias proactiva.
- Optimización del cronograma: Identificar las tareas que pueden ejecutarse en paralelo desbloquea oportunidades de compresión, acortando el cronograma sin añadir alcance ni recursos.
Un estudio de Harvard Business Review de 2025 sobre gestión visual de dependencias reveló que los equipos de proyecto que usaban diagramas de red redujeron los retrasos no planificados en un 28% en comparación con los equipos que dependían únicamente de listas de tareas. El mecanismo es simple: cuando las personas ven la cadena, la protegen.
Los 4 tipos esenciales de dependencias en la gestión de proyectos
La Guía del PMBOK® define cuatro tipos de relaciones lógicas, conocidos colectivamente como relaciones del método de diagramación de precedencia (PDM). Dominar los cuatro es un requisito previo para el examen PMP® y para diseñar cronogramas de proyecto sólidos.
| Tipo | Lógica | Ejemplo real |
|---|---|---|
| Final a Inicio (FS) | B no puede comenzar hasta que A termine | Las pruebas comienzan después de que termina la codificación |
| Inicio a Inicio (SS) | B no puede comenzar hasta que A comience | La documentación comienza cuando comienza el desarrollo |
| Final a Final (FF) | B no puede terminar hasta que A termine | La aprobación de QA y las UAT terminan juntas |
| Inicio a Final (SF) | B no puede terminar hasta que A comience | Cambio de turno: el nuevo turno comienza antes de que termine el anterior |
Final a Inicio (FS)
Final a Inicio es el tipo de dependencia predeterminado, el que la mayoría de los directores de proyectos consideran primero. La Tarea B no puede comenzar hasta que la Tarea A esté completamente terminada. Esta es la relación más común en las metodologías waterfall e híbridas: los requisitos deben terminar antes de que comience el diseño; el diseño debe terminar antes de que comience el desarrollo.
Ejemplo real: Una obra de construcción no puede comenzar a armar la estructura (Tarea B) hasta que el vaciado de la cimentación haya curado (Tarea A). No es posible ningún solapamiento, ya que la física del hormigón impone la dependencia.
Inicio a Inicio (SS)
Inicio a Inicio habilita el trabajo en paralelo. La Tarea B puede comenzar una vez que la Tarea A ha comenzado, no después de que termine. Este es el motor de la compresión del cronograma: al identificar las relaciones SS en el diagrama de dependencias, los directores de proyecto pueden solapar paquetes de trabajo y acortar la ruta crítica sin aumentar el riesgo.
Ejemplo real: En una versión de software, el equipo de redacción técnica puede comenzar a redactar las notas de la versión (Tarea B) tan pronto como comience el desarrollo de funcionalidades (Tarea A). Ambas actividades se ejecutan en paralelo, ahorrando días o semanas en el cronograma.
Final a Final (FF)
Final a Final sincroniza salidas. La Tarea B no puede terminar hasta que la Tarea A termine. Esta relación es común cuando dos actividades deben concluir juntas para mantener la calidad o el cumplimiento normativo, ya que ninguna salida es útil sin que la otra esté completa.
Ejemplo real: En un ensayo farmacéutico regulado, la recopilación de datos de pacientes (Tarea A) y el informe de eventos adversos (Tarea B) deben concluir simultáneamente. El informe no puede finalizarse hasta que se cierre la recopilación de datos.
Inicio a Final (SF)
Inicio a Final es la relación más rara y contraintuitiva en un diagrama de dependencias. La Tarea B no puede terminar hasta que la Tarea A haya comenzado. Se encuentra con mayor frecuencia en producción justo a tiempo y en escenarios de traspaso operativo donde la actividad sucesora debe mantenerse activa hasta que la predecesora entre en funcionamiento.
Ejemplo real: Un traspaso de turno en un hospital: el turno nocturno (Tarea B) no puede terminar oficialmente hasta que el turno diurno (Tarea A) haya comenzado. Esto evita cualquier brecha en la atención al paciente, independientemente del horario.
Consejo PMP: Las dependencias SF rara vez se examinan de forma aislada, pero aparecen con frecuencia en preguntas de examen basadas en escenarios. Comprender la analogía del traspaso de turno es la forma más fiable de reconocer la lógica SF disfrazada.
Cómo elaborar un diagrama de dependencias: guía en 4 pasos
Construir un diagrama de dependencias es un proceso estructurado. Saltarse pasos, en particular el paso 2, es la causa más común de diagramas que parecen profesionales pero fallan operativamente.
Paso 1: listado de tareas
Comienza con una Estructura de Desglose del Trabajo (EDT) completa. Cada paquete de trabajo al nivel de entregable en tu EDT se convierte en un nodo candidato en el diagrama de dependencias. Asigna un ID único a cada tarea y registra su duración estimada. Los inventarios de tareas incompletos producen diagramas de dependencias incompletos, lo cual es peor que no tener ninguno porque generan falsa confianza.
Paso 2: definición de la lógica
Para cada par de tareas, determina el tipo de dependencia (FS, SS, FF o SF) e identifica si la dependencia es:
- Obligatoria (lógica dura): Física o legalmente requerida, como el hormigón antes de la estructura o la aprobación regulatoria antes del lanzamiento.
- Discrecional (lógica blanda): Secuenciación de mejores prácticas que podría modificarse, generalmente usada para gestionar riesgos o calidad.
- Externa: Dependiente de una entidad fuera del equipo del proyecto, como una entrega de proveedor, aprobación del cliente o emisión de permisos.
- Interna: Dependiente de otra tarea bajo el control directo del equipo del proyecto.
Esta clasificación es importante porque las dependencias obligatorias son restricciones inamovibles, mientras que las discrecionales son palancas de compresión del cronograma.
Paso 3: selección de herramienta
Elige tu herramienta de diagramación en función de la complejidad del proyecto, la distribución del equipo y los requisitos de integración:
- Gliffy / Lucidchart: Ideal para mapeo visual de dependencias con arrastrar y soltar. Perfectos para presentaciones a stakeholders y equipos con diferentes perfiles técnicos.
- Microsoft Project / Primavera P6: Herramientas empresariales que generan automáticamente diagramas de red a partir de datos de tareas y calculan la ruta crítica de forma algorítmica.
- Mermaid.js: Diagramación de código abierto nativa en código. Ideal para equipos técnicos que usan GitOps, documentación como código o pipelines CI/CD.
- Monday.com / Asana: Plataformas colaborativas con seguimiento de dependencias integrado y vistas de Gantt, muy adecuadas para equipos ágiles o híbridos.
Paso 4: mapeo de conexiones
Con tu herramienta seleccionada y las tareas introducidas, define cada relación utilizando la lógica determinada en el Paso 2. Trabaja de izquierda a derecha, desde el inicio hasta el final del proyecto. Valida el diagrama de dependencias recorriendo cada camino desde el primer nodo hasta el último y confirmando que todas las restricciones son lógicamente coherentes. Ejecuta un pase hacia adelante y hacia atrás para calcular las fechas de inicio y fin tempranas y tardías, la base del análisis de la ruta crítica.
Mejores prácticas en la gestión de dependencias
Los diagramas de dependencias son documentos vivos, no entregables de una sola vez. Las siguientes prácticas distinguen a las PMO de alto rendimiento de los equipos que construyen diagramas una vez y los olvidan.
Integración con la ruta crítica
Cada diagrama de dependencias debe ir acompañado de un análisis de la ruta crítica. La ruta crítica es la secuencia más larga de tareas con flotación cero y define el piso inamovible de la fecha límite. Cualquier retraso en una tarea de la ruta crítica retrasa la fecha de finalización del proyecto en una cantidad idéntica.
Mejor práctica: codifica en colores las tareas de la ruta crítica en tu diagrama de dependencias (el rojo es el estándar del PMBOK). Revisa la ruta crítica en cada reunión de seguimiento. Cuando se produzcan cambios de alcance, vuelve a ejecutar el pase hacia adelante y hacia atrás de inmediato, ya que los cambios de alcance suelen modificar qué ruta es crítica.
Detección automatizada de riesgos mediante IA
Las plataformas PMO modernas integran modelos de aprendizaje automático que señalan dependencias en riesgo antes de que se materialicen los retrasos. Estos sistemas analizan datos de rendimiento histórico, velocidad actual de las tareas, utilización de recursos y eventos del calendario externo para asignar una puntuación de probabilidad a cada nodo de dependencia.
Cuando un nodo de dependencia supera un umbral de riesgo (típicamente 70% o más de probabilidad de retraso), el sistema activa una notificación automática al responsable de la tarea y al director del proyecto. Esto transforma la gestión de dependencias de reactiva (“el retraso ocurrió”) a predictiva (“el retraso es probable, actúa ahora”).
Incluso sin una plataforma con IA, los equipos pueden aproximar esta capacidad manualmente etiquetando las dependencias externas, asignando márgenes de flotación a las rutas de alto riesgo y programando puntos de revisión de dependencias semanales.
Plantillas de dependencias en gestión de proyectos y ejemplos visuales
Dos formatos visuales dominan la documentación de dependencias en la gestión de proyectos profesional:
Diagrama de red (Método de Diagramación de Precedencia)
El diagrama de red es la forma más pura de un diagrama de dependencias. Cada tarea ocupa un nodo (caja rectangular) que muestra el ID de la tarea, el nombre, la duración, el inicio temprano (IT), el fin temprano (FT), el inicio tardío (ItL) y el fin tardío (FTL). Las flechas entre nodos muestran el tipo de relación. La ruta crítica se resalta y la flotación es visualmente evidente a partir de la diferencia entre los valores IT/ItL.
Los diagramas de red son el formato de elección para las preguntas del examen PMP, el análisis CPM y las presentaciones formales de cronograma a clientes o patrocinadores. Se generan de manera más efectiva mediante herramientas de planificación que calculan automáticamente la flotación y los valores de la ruta crítica.
Texto alternativo para visual: “Ejemplo de diagrama de dependencias de proyecto que muestra relaciones FS y SS en un diagrama de red con la ruta crítica resaltada.”
Diagrama de Gantt con flechas de dependencia
El diagrama de Gantt es el formato de cronograma de proyecto más ampliamente reconocido. Cuando se añaden flechas de dependencia que conectan el final de una barra con el inicio de la siguiente, el Gantt se convierte efectivamente en un diagrama de dependencias en forma de línea de tiempo. Este formato híbrido es muy accesible para los interesados ejecutivos que pueden no estar familiarizados con la notación de diagramas de red.
En Microsoft Project, Primavera P6 y Monday.com, las flechas de dependencia del Gantt se generan automáticamente a partir de la lógica de tareas introducida en el cronograma. Cambiar un tipo de dependencia actualiza instantáneamente la geometría de las flechas.
Texto alternativo para visual: “Diagrama de Gantt con flechas de dependencia que muestran relaciones Final-a-Inicio e Inicio-a-Inicio a lo largo de un cronograma de proyecto de 12 semanas.”
Para los equipos que buscan un punto de partida ya preparado, una plantilla de dependencias de gestión de proyectos debe incluir: una tabla de inventario de tareas, una columna de clasificación del tipo de dependencia, un lienzo de diagrama de red basado en nodos y una vista de Gantt con barras vinculadas. Estos elementos en conjunto constituyen una plantilla de dependencias de proyecto completa, adecuada para cualquier metodología, ya sea waterfall, híbrida o ágil a escala.
Preguntas frecuentes (FAQ)
¿Cuál es la mejor herramienta para mapear dependencias de proyecto?
La respuesta depende de la madurez técnica de tu equipo y de la complejidad del proyecto. Para programas empresariales, Primavera P6 y Microsoft Project siguen siendo el estándar de oro, ya que calculan automáticamente la ruta crítica y se integran con sistemas ERP. Para equipos colaborativos de mercado medio, Lucidchart y Monday.com ofrecen el mejor equilibrio entre usabilidad y profundidad de funcionalidades. Para equipos técnicos que operan en entornos GitOps o de documentación como código, Mermaid.js es la elección clara: gratuito, con control de versiones y compatible con IA. La configuración ideal para la mayoría de las organizaciones es un enfoque de dos capas, con Mermaid para la creación rápida de prototipos y documentación, y una plataforma de planificación para la gestión formal del cronograma.
¿Cómo se rastrean y resuelven los conflictos de recursos en un diagrama de dependencias?
Los conflictos de recursos surgen cuando dos o más tareas con una dependencia compartida se asignan al mismo recurso al mismo tiempo. El diagrama de dependencias identifica las tareas y la nivelación de recursos resuelve el conflicto. En la práctica: (1) ejecuta un histograma de recursos para encontrar los picos de sobreasignación, (2) identifica cuál de las tareas en conflicto tiene flotación, (3) retrasa la tarea con flotación hasta que el recurso esté disponible. Si ambas tareas están en la ruta crítica con flotación cero, debes añadir recursos, reducir el alcance o aceptar una extensión del cronograma. Las plataformas PMO con IA pueden automatizar los pasos 1 y 2, acelerando drásticamente el proceso de resolución.
¿Cuál es la diferencia entre dependencias internas y externas?
Las dependencias internas conectan tareas que están bajo el control directo del equipo del proyecto. Las dependencias externas conectan una tarea del proyecto con un entregable o hito perteneciente a una parte fuera del equipo, como un proveedor, un organismo regulador, un cliente o un proyecto paralelo. La distinción crítica es la exposición al riesgo: las dependencias internas se pueden gestionar directamente, mientras que las externas requieren gestión activa de relaciones, SLAs contractuales y márgenes de contingencia. En tu diagrama de dependencias, marca las dependencias externas con un color o icono distintivo para que reciban una atención de seguimiento reforzada a lo largo del ciclo de vida del proyecto.
¿En qué se diferencia un diagrama de dependencias de una EDT?
Una Estructura de Desglose del Trabajo (EDT) responde a la pregunta “¿Qué hay que hacer?” ya que descompone el alcance del proyecto en entregables de forma jerárquica. Un diagrama de dependencias responde a “¿En qué orden?” ya que secuencia los paquetes de trabajo de la EDT según las restricciones lógicas. Las dos herramientas son complementarias: primero construyes la EDT para inventariar todo el trabajo, luego construyes el diagrama de dependencias para secuenciar ese trabajo. Ninguna sustituye a la otra.
Empieza a mapear tus dependencias hoy mismo
Un diagrama de dependencias bien construido es una de las inversiones de mayor impacto que puede hacer un director de proyectos. Transforma una maraña inmanejable de tareas en una red clara y navegable, donde cada miembro del equipo comprende no solo lo que le corresponde, sino por qué el momento de su trabajo importa a todos los que están aguas abajo.
Tanto si te estás preparando para el examen PMP®, diseñando una transformación TI compleja o liderando el lanzamiento de un producto multi-equipo, el diagrama de dependencias es tu única fuente de verdad para la lógica del cronograma. Comienza con la guía de 4 pasos de este artículo, valida tus tipos de dependencia con el marco FS/SS/FF/SF y controla las versiones de tus diagramas utilizando Mermaid.js para lograr la máxima transparencia y mantenibilidad.
¿Listo para poner en práctica este conocimiento? Explora nuestros recursos de Formación para la Certificación PMP y el Simulador del Examen PMP para dominar la gestión de dependencias y el análisis de la ruta crítica de cara al examen PMP®.
Referencias y lectura adicional
- Project Management Institute (2026). Guía PMBOK® – Estándares de la Octava Edición para el Mapeo de Dependencias
- Documentación de Mermaid.js (2026). Generación de Grafos de Dependencias mediante Sintaxis
- Harvard Business Review (2025). El Impacto de la Gestión Visual de Dependencias en el ROI del Proyecto
Sobre nosotros
Somos una academia internacional nacida en Suiza que forma y acompaña a profesionales de todo el mundo y todos los niveles en su desarrollo en Project Management.
¡Síguenos en redes!
Suscríbete a la newsletter
Recibe consejos prácticos, descuentos para tu examen, información de alto valor y las últimas novedades y recursos clave en Project Management.
¡Únete a nuestra comunidad de PM!
Doble títulación profesional
Scrum Master®
- Desde cero, en 6 meses
- 100% online, disponible 24/7
- Simuladores Scrum Master®
- Sesión 1:1 de mentoring
- Tasas de examen incluidas


